Understanding 'No Credit Land' and Its Challenges
When you have no credit or a very limited credit history, lenders lack the data points they typically use to evaluate your creditworthiness. This scenario, often described as 'no credit land,' means that banks and credit unions may view you as a higher risk, even if you have a stable income. It’s a classic Catch-22: you need credit to build credit, but you can't get credit without it.
Why Building Credit Matters
While navigating immediate financial needs is crucial, it's also important to consider long-term financial health. Building a positive credit history can open doors to better interest rates on future loans, easier apartment rentals, and even lower insurance premiums. For those in 'no credit land,' starting with secured credit cards or small, credit-builder loans can be effective strategies over time. However, these solutions don't always address immediate cash needs.
